AN/TXC-1 came out in late 1944. Earliest manual that I have is dated
1/1/45. But it is TM 11-4038, the Repair Manual. Generally, the repair manuals
lagged behind the system manuals by a few months. RC-58 was an earlier
vehicular set. The one manual that I have on it is dated 02/23/44.
